Arsenal may be closing in on the signing of Viktor Gyokeres.

The Gunners have completed four deals in the summer transfer window thus far, but manager Mikel Arteta says the plan is to continue adding to their squad ahead of the new season.

And amid links to the aforementioned Sporting striker, the Spaniard refused to comment on a deal but did hint that he hopes a move can be sealed eventually.

“You know I cannot comment on any player that is not part of our group yet,” he said during a press conference in Singapore on Monday.“When we have something concrete to offer in any case to any player, we will do that.”

However, Sporting have been playing hardball over the sale and there are reports that the delay is due to a debate over the nature and structure of the bonuses included.

That said, there is optimism a deal can be struck and an agreement could be reached very soon with Sporting said to close to signing a replacement for Gyokeres.

Former Watford striker Luis Javier Suarez has been earmarked to take over the mantle as chief goalscorer next season, but Almeria sporting director, Joao Goncalves, issued a major warning over the weekend.

Speaking to CNN Portugal, Goncalves said: “Luis has had his best season, he’s in the best moment of his career – 31 goals is a number any forward wants to achieve.

“We haven’t had any official contact with Sporting to date.

“We haven’t received any formal or informal contact, but we have with other clubs, and we’re moving forward with negotiations with other clubs. We’re managing our timing.

“He has a €40 million (£34.6m) release clause. To paraphrase Frederico Varandas – we’re not asking for the value of the clause, but we’re going to defend our interests.”

Sporting appear to have taken that warning on board as Fabrizio Romano has reported that talks with Almeria for Suarez have accelerated in recent hours with the final details for a transfer to be sorted this week.
